Pentagon assures USA to effectively work with AFU new military chief
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y has a right to choose who leads Ukraine's military and the United States will work effectively with his new military chief, Celeste Wallander, the assistant secretary of defense for international security affairs at the Pentagon, Reuters reported.
"President Zelenskyy is the president of his country and Ukraine, unlike Russia, has a democratic civilian control of the military," Pentagon’s representative said.
Wallander called Syrsky "an experienced, successful commander."
As previously reported, President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y announced in an evening address that Oleksandr Syrsky had been appointed commander-in-Chief of the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
